About the role

  • Product Line Manager driving innovation for Fiber Access Products at Nokia. Collaborating with customers to create state-of-the-art solutions with a focus on technology advancements.

Responsibilities

  • As a Product Line Manager within the BBN Fiber Business Line, you will drive innovation by defining features and functions for advanced Fiber Access Products.
  • Collaborate closely with customers, sales, and regional development teams to create state-of-the-art solutions aligning with customer needs.
  • Your insights and leadership will directly influence the product roadmap, ensuring we remain at the forefront of technology.
  • Collect market requirements and associated business opportunities for Fiber Access Products.
  • Work with PLM peers and R&D to define the product roadmap that will allow matching the financial targets of the Business Line.
  • Translate customer needs into clearly defined solution and product requirements considering available solutions and competitive environment.
  • Keep update competitive environment and technologies to support responses to vulnerabilities and leverage strengths and differentiators.
  • Collaborate with Sales and Pre-sales team to grow the adoption of Fiber Access solution into customers' network.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of product management or Access network system design and development experience.
  • Graduate degree in a relevant technical field or an MBA in addition to a technical degree.
  • Deep knowledge of xPON technology, fiber access solutions, and redundancy schemes.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ills with the ability to engage diverse audiences.
  • Familiarity with current and emerging standards in both packet and PON domains.
  • Strong consulting and negotiation skills to influence and lead stakeholders.
  • Proven ability to manage projects autonomously in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
  • Nice to have:
  • Experience in delivering presentations at conferences or trade shows.
  • Knowledge of network automation aspects specifically related to access networks.
  • Proven problem-solving skills with the ability to coach less experienced colleagues.
